BIO.B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

7 of the 3,749 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bio-Rad Laboratories Class B (BIO.B)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$3.55M — down 75% from $14.1M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in BIO.B was balanced in Q4 2014: 2 funds opened new positions, 2 closed out, 0 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was First New York Securities,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.26K. The largest seller was Tikvah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$10.8M sold.
